Job Description FANUC Robotics Trainer / Subject Matter Expert (SME)
Role: FANUC Robotics Trainer / Subject Matter Expert (SME)
Experience: 8+ years of hands‑on FANUC robotics experience with prior training or instructor experience preferred.
We are seeking an experienced FANUC Robotics Trainer / Subject Matter Expert (SME) to deliver technical training and hands‑on instruction to operators, technicians, and engineers. The ideal candidate will have strong practical experience with FANUC robotic systems, excellent communication skills, and the ability to develop and deliver effective training programs.
Key Responsibilities- Deliver instructor‑led FANUC robotics training, including both classroom sessions and hands‑on practical training.
- Train operators, technicians, and engineers on robot operation, setup, programming, troubleshooting, and safety procedures.
- Provide training on FANUC Teach Pendant usage, robot motion, coordinate systems, frames, and related programming concepts.
- Develop and customize training materials, exercises, guides, and practical demonstrations based on learning requirements.
- Deliver application‑focused training for robotic processes such as welding, blasting, inspection, and other industrial automation applications.
- Evaluate trainee performance, assess competency levels, and identify areas for improvement.
- Collaborate with internal teams and stakeholders to understand training objectives and ensure effective knowledge transfer.
- Continuously improve training content, delivery methods, and learning programs.
Skills & Qualifications
- 8+ years of hands‑on experience working with FANUC industrial robots.
- Strong expertise in FANUC robot operation, programming, setup, calibration, and troubleshooting.
- Proven experience delivering technical training in classroom and hands‑on environments.
- Experience creating training materials, practical exercises, and technical documentation.
- Excellent commun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ills.
- Strong manufacturing, industrial automation, or shop‑floor experience.
- Ability to explain complex robotics concepts clearly to different skill levels.
- Experience working in Aerospace, MRO, or advanced manufacturing environments.
- Exposure to robotic applications such as welding, blasting, inspection, or automated processes.
- Previous experience as a Robotics Trainer, Instructor, Technical Specialist, or SME.
- Knowledge of industrial automation systems and robotics integration.
